Mitchell Hashimoto c247e455c2 config: refill after ignored line boundaries
Refill the line iterator when an ignored comment or blank line
consumes the remaining buffered data.

Configuration parsing previously stopped silently at these boundaries
and left every subsequent setting unapplied.

Request more data before continuing the loop and cover both comment
and blank line boundaries with buffered-reader regression tests.

Subcommand Actions

This is the cli specific code. It contains cli actions and tui definitions and argument parsing.

This README is meant as developer documentation and not as user documentation. For user documentation, see the main README or ghostty.org.

Updating documentation

Each cli action is defined in it's own file. Documentation for each action is defined in the doc comment associated with the run function. For example the run function in list_keybinds.zig contains the help text for ghostty +list-keybinds.
